  • Upgrade Your Existing BI Publisher 11g (11.1.1.3) to 11.1.1.5

    - by Kan Nishida
    It’s already more than a month now since BI Publisher 11.1.1.5 was released at beginning of May. Have you already tried out many of the great new features? If you are already running on the first version of BI Publisher 11g (11.1.1.3) you might wonder how to upgrade the existing BI Publisher to the 11.1.1.5 version. There are two ways to do this, one is ‘Out-Place’ and another is ‘In-Place’. The ‘Out-Place’ would be quite simple. Basically you will need to install the whole BI or just BI Publisher standalone R11.1.1.5 at a different location then you can switch the catalog to the existing one so that all the reports will be there in the new 11.1.1.5 environment. But sometimes things are not that simple, you might have some custom applications or configuration on the original environment and you want to keep all of them with the upgraded environment. For such scenarios, there is the ‘In-Place’ upgrade, which overrides on top of the original environment only the parts relevant for BI and BI Publisher, and that’s what I’m going to talk about today. Here is the basic steps of the ‘In-Place’ upgrade. Upgrade WebLogic Server to 10.3.5 Upgrade BI System to 11.1.1.5 Upgrade Database Schema Re-register BI Components Upgrade FMW (Fusion Middleware) Configuration Upgrade BI Catalog There is a section that talks about this upgrade from 11.1.1.3 to 11.1.1.5 as part of the overall upgrade document. But I hope my blog post summarized it and made it simple for you to cover only what’s necessary. Upgrade Document: http://download.oracle.com/docs/cd/E21764_01/bi.1111/e16452/bi_plan.htm#BABECJJH Before You Start Stop BI System and Backup I can’t emphasize enough, but before you start PLEASE make sure you take a backup of the existing environments first. You want to stop all WebLogic Servers, Node Manager, OPMN, and OPMN-managed system components that are part of your Oracle BI domains. If you’re on Windows you can do this by simply selecting ‘Stop BI Services’ menu. Then backup the whole system. Upgrade WebLogic Server to 10.3.5 Download WebLogic Server 10.3.5 Upgrade Installer With BI 11.1.1.3 installation your WebLogic Server (WLS) is 10.3.3 and you need to upgrade this to 10.3.5 before upgrading the BI part. In order to upgrade you will need this 10.3.5 upgrade version of WLS, which you can download from our support web site (https://support.oracle.com) You can find the detail information about the installation and the patch numbers for the WLS upgrade installer on this document. Just for your short cut, if you are running on Windows or Linux (x86) here is the patch number for your platform. Windows 32 bit: 12395517: Linux: 12395517 Upgrade WebLogic Server 1. After unzip the downloaded file, launch wls1035_upgrade_win32.exe if you’re on Windows. 2. Accept all the default values and keep ‘Next’ till end, and start the upgrade. Once the upgrade process completes you’ll see the following window. Now let’s move to the BI upgrade. Upgrade BI Platform to 11.1.1.5 with Software Only Install Download BI 11.1.1.5 You can download the 11.1.1.5 version from our OTN page for your evaluation or development. For the production use it’s recommended to download from eDelivery. 1. Launch the installer by double click ‘setup.exe’ (for Windows) 2. Select ‘Software Only Install’ option 3. Select your original Oracle Home where you installed BI 11.1.1.3. 4. Click ‘Install’ button to start the installation. And now the software part of the BI has been upgraded to 11.1.1.5. Now let’s move to the database schema upgrade. Upgrade Database Schema with Patch Assistant You need to upgrade the BIPLATFORM and MDS Schemas. You can use the Patch Assistant utility to do this, and here is an example assuming you’ve created the schema with ‘DEV’ prefix, otherwise change it with yours accordingly. Upgrade BIPLATFORM schema (if you created this schema with DEV_ prev) psa.bat -dbConnectString localhost:1521:orcl -dbaUserName sys -schemaUserName DEV_BIPLATFORM Upgrade MDS schema (if you created this schema with DEV_ prev) psa.bat -dbConnectString localhost:1521:orcl -dbaUserName sys -schemaUserName DEV_MDS Re-register BI System components Now you need to re-register your BI system components such as BI Server, BI Presentation Server, etc to the Fusion Middleware system. You can do this by running ‘upgradenonj2eeapp.bat (or .sh)’ command, which can be found at %ORACLE_HOME%/opmn/bin. Before you run, you need to start the WLS Server and make sure your WLS environment is not locked. If it’s locked then you need to release the system from the Fusion Middleware console before you run the following command. Here is the syntax for the ‘upgradenonj2eeapp.bat (or .sh) command.  upgradenonj2eeapp.bat    -oracleInstance Instance_Home_Location    -adminHost WebLogic_Server_Host_Name    -adminPort administration_server_port_number    -adminUsername administration_server_user And here is an example: cd %BI_HOME%\opmn\bin upgradenonj2eeapp.bat -oracleInstance C:\biee11\instances\instance1 -adminHost localhost -adminPort 7001 -adminUsername weblogic Upgrade Fusion Middleware Configuration There are a couple things on the Fusion Middleware need to be upgraded for the BI system to work. Here is a list of the components to upgrade. Upgrade Shared Library (JRF) Upgrade Fusion Middleware Security (OPSS) Upgrade Code Grants Upgrade OWSM Policy Repository Before moving forward, you need to stop the WebLogic Server. Here is an example. cd %MW_HOME%user_projects\domains\bifoundation_domain\binstopWebLogic.cmd And, let’s start with ‘Upgrade Shared Library (JRF)’. Upgrade Shared Library (JRF) You can use updateJRF() WLST command to upgrade the shared libraries in your domain. Before you do this, you need to stop all running instances, Managed Servers, Administration Server, and Node Manager in the domain. Here is an example of the ‘upgradeJRF()’ command: cd %MW_HOME%\oracle_common\common\bin wlst.cmd upgradeJRF('C:/biee11/user_projects/domains/bifoundation_domain') Upgrade Fusion Middleware Security (OPSS) This step is to upgrade the Fusion Middleware security piece. You can use ‘upgradeOpss()’ WLST command. Here is a syntax for the command. upgradeOpss(jpsConfig="existing_jps_config_file", jaznData="system_jazn_data_file") The ‘existing jps-config.xml file can be found under %DOMAIN_HOME%/config/fmwconfig/jps-config.xml and the ‘system_jazn_data_file’ can be found under %MW_HOME%/oracle_common/modules/oracle.jps_11.1.1/domain_config/system-jazn-data.xml. And here is an example: cd %MW_HOME%\oracle_common\common\bin wlst.cmd upgradeOpss(jpsConfig="c:/biee11/user_projects/domains/bifoundation_domain/config/fmwconfig/jps-config.xml", jaznData="c:/biee11/oracle_common/modules/oracle.jps_11.1.1/domain_config/system-jazn-data.xml") exit() Upgrade Code Grants for Oracle BI Domain And this is the last step for the Fusion Middleware platform upgrade task. You need to run this python script ‘bi-upgrade.py‘ script to configure the code grants necessary to ensure that SSL works correctly for Oracle BI. However, even if you don’t use SSL, you still need to run this script. And if you have multiple BI domains (Enterprise deployment) then you need to run this on each domain. Here is an example: cd %MW_HOME%\oracle_common\common\bin wlst c:\biee11\Oracle_BI1\bin\bi-upgrade.py --bioraclehome c:\biee11\Oracle_BI1 --domainhome c:\biee11\user_projects\domains\bifoundation_domain Upgrade OWSM Policy Repository This is to upgrade OWSM (Oracle Web Service Manager) policy repository, you can use WLST command ‘upgradeWSMPolicyRepository()’. In order to run this command you need to have your WebLogic Server up-and-running. Here is an example. cd %MW_HOME%user_projects\domains\bifoundation_domain\binstopWebLogic.cmd cd %MW_HOME%\oracle_common\common\bin wlst.cmd connect ('weblogic','welcome1','t3://localhost:7001') upgradeWSMPolicyRepository() exit() Upgrade BI Catalogs This step is required only when you have your BI Publisher integrated with BIEE. If your BI Publisher is deployed as a standalone then you don’t need to follow this step. Now finally, you can upgrade the BI catalog. This won’t upgrade your BI Publisher reports themselves, but it just upgrades some attributes information inside the catalog. Before you do this upgrade, make sure the BI system components are not running. You can check the status by the command below. opmnctl status You can do the upgrade by updating a configuration file ‘instanceconfig.xml’, which can be found at %BI_HOME%\instances\instance1\config\coreapplication_obips1, and change the value of ‘UpgradeAndExit’ to be ‘true’. Here is an example: <ps:Catalog xmlns:ps="oracle.bi.presentation.services/config/v1.1"> <ps:UpgradeAndExit>true</ps:UpgradeAndExit> </ps:Catalog> After you made the change and save the file, you need to start the BI Presentation Server. This time you want to start only the BI Presentation Server instead of starting all the servers. You can use ‘opmnctl’ to do so, and here is an example. cd %ORACLE_INSTANCE%\bin opmnctl startproc ias-component=coreapplication_obips1 This would upgrade your BI Catalog to be 11.1.1.5. After the catalog is updated, you can stop the BI Presentation Server so that you can modify the instanceconfig.xml file again to revert the upgradeAndExit value back to ‘false’. Start Explore BI Publisher 11.1.1.5 After all the above steps, you can start all the BI Services, access to the same URL, now you have your BI Publisher and/or BI 11.1.1.5 in your hands. Have fun exploring all the new features of R11.1.1.5!

  • This Week in Geek History: Gmail Goes Public, Deep Blue Wins at Chess, and the Birth of Thomas Edison

    - by Jason Fitzpatrick
    Every week we bring you a snapshot of the week in Geek History. This week we’re taking a peek at the public release of Gmail, the first time a computer won against a chess champion, and the birth of prolific inventor Thomas Edison. Gmail Goes Public It’s hard to believe that Gmail has only been around for seven years and that for the first three years of its life it was invite only. In 2007 Gmail dropped the invite only requirement (although they would hold onto the “beta” tag for another two years) and opened its doors for anyone to grab a username @gmail. For what seemed like an entire epoch in internet history Gmail had the slickest web-based email around with constant innovations and features rolling out from Gmail Labs. Only in the last year or so have major overhauls at competitors like Hotmail and Yahoo! Mail brought other services up to speed. Can’t stand reading a Week in Geek History entry without a random fact? Here you go: gmail.com was originally owned by the Garfield franchise and ran a service that delivered Garfield comics to your email inbox. No, we’re not kidding. Deep Blue Proves Itself a Chess Master Deep Blue was a super computer constructed by IBM with the sole purpose of winning chess matches. In 2011 with the all seeing eye of Google and the amazing computational abilities of engines like Wolfram Alpha we simply take powerful computers immersed in our daily lives for granted. The 1996 match against reigning world chest champion Garry Kasparov where in Deep Blue held its own, but ultimately lost, in a  4-2 match shook a lot of people up. What did it mean if something that was considered such an elegant and quintessentially human endeavor such as chess was so easy for a machine? A series of upgrades helped Deep Blue outright win a match against Kasparov in 1997 (seen in the photo above). After the win Deep Blue was retired and disassembled. Parts of Deep Blue are housed in the National Museum of History and the Computer History Museum. Birth of Thomas Edison Thomas Alva Edison was one of the most prolific inventors in history and holds an astounding 1,093 US Patents. He is responsible for outright inventing or greatly refining major innovations in the history of world culture including the phonograph, the movie camera, the carbon microphone used in nearly every telephone well into the 1980s, batteries for electric cars (a notion we’d take over a century to take seriously), voting machines, and of course his enormous contribution to electric distribution systems. Despite the role of scientist and inventor being largely unglamorous, Thomas Edison and his tumultuous relationship with fellow inventor Nikola Tesla have been fodder for everything from books, to comics, to movies, and video games.   • SQL SERVER – Attach mdf file without ldf file in Database

    - by pinaldave
    Background Story: One of my friends recently called up and asked me if I had spare time to look at his database and give him a performance tuning advice. Because I had some free time to help him out, I said yes. I asked him to send me the details of his database structure and sample data. He said that since his database is in a very early stage and is small as of the moment, so he told me that he would like me to have a complete database. My response to him was “Sure! In that case, take a backup of the database and send it to me. I will restore it into my computer and play with it.” He did send me his database; however, his method made me write this quick note here. Instead of taking a full backup of the database and sending it to me, he sent me only the .mdf (primary database file). In fact, I asked for a complete backup (I wanted to review file groups, files, as well as few other details).  Upon calling my friend,  I found that he was not available. Now,  he left me with only a .mdf file. As I had some extra time, I decided to checkout his database structure and get back to him regarding the full backup, whenever I can get in touch with him again. Technical Talk: If the database is shutdown gracefully and there was no abrupt shutdown (power outrages, pulling plugs to machines, machine crashes or any other reasons), it is possible (there’s no guarantee) to attach .mdf file only to the server. Please note that there can be many more reasons for a database that is not getting attached or restored. In my case, the database had a clean shutdown and there were no complex issues. I was able to recreate a transaction log file and attached the received .mdf file. There are multiple ways of doing this. I am listing all of them here. Before using any of them, please consult the Domain Expert in your company or industry. Also, never attempt this on live/production server without the presence of a Disaster Recovery expert. USE [master] GO -- Method 1: I use this method EXEC sp_attach_single_file_db @dbname='TestDb', @physname=N'C:\Program Files\Microsoft SQL Server\MSSQL10.MSSQLSERVER\MSSQL\DATA\TestDb.mdf' GO -- Method 2: CREATE DATABASE TestDb ON (FILENAME = N'C:\Program Files\Microsoft SQL Server\MSSQL10.MSSQLSERVER\MSSQL\DATA\TestDb.mdf') FOR ATTACH_REBUILD_LOG GO Method 2: If one or more log files are missing, they are recreated again. There is one more method which I am demonstrating here but I have not used myself before. According to Book Online, it will work only if there is one log file that is missing. If there are more than one log files involved, all of them are required to undergo the same procedure. -- Method 3: CREATE DATABASE TestDb ON ( FILENAME = N'C:\Program Files\Microsoft SQL Server\MSSQL10.MSSQLSERVER\MSSQL\DATA\TestDb.mdf') FOR ATTACH GO Please read the Book Online in depth and consult DR experts before working on the production server. In my case, the above syntax just worked fine as the database was clean when it was detached.   • SQL SERVER – Error: Fix – Msg 208 – Invalid object name ‘dbo.backupset’ – Invalid object name ‘dbo.backupfile’

    - by pinaldave
    Just a day before I got a very interesting email. Here is the email (modified a bit to make it relevant to this blog post). “Pinal, We are facing a very strange issue. One of our query  related to backup files and backup set has stopped working suddenly in SSMS. It works fine in application where we have and in the stored procedure but when we have it in our SSMS it gives following error. Msg 208, Level 16, State 1, Line 1 Invalid object name ‘dbo.backupfile’. Here are our queries which we are trying to execute. SELECT name, database_name, backup_size, TYPE, compatibility_level, backup_set_id FROM dbo.backupset; SELECT logical_name, backup_size, file_type FROM dbo.backupfile; This query gives us details related to backupset and backup files when the backup was taken.” When I receive this kind of email, usually I have no answers directly. The claim that it works in stored procedure and in application but not in SSMS gives me no real data. I have requested him to very first check following two things: If he is connected to correct server? His answer was yes. If he has enough permissions? His answer was he was logged in as an admin. This means there was something more to it and I requested him to send me a screenshot of the his SSMS. He promptly sends that to me and as soon as I receive the screen shot I knew what was going on. Before I say anything take a look at the screenshot yourself and see if you can figure out why his queries are not working in SSMS. Just to make your life a bit easy, I have already given a hint in the image. The answer is very simple, the context of the database is master database. To execute above two queries the context of the database has to be msdb. Tables backupset and backupfile belong to the database msdb only. Here are two workaround or solution to above problem: 1) Change context to MSDB Above two queries when they will run as following they will not error out and will give the accurate desired result. USE msdb GO SELECT name, database_name, backup_size, TYPE, compatibility_level, backup_set_id FROM dbo.backupset; SELECT logical_name, backup_size, file_type FROM dbo.backupfile; 2) Prefix the query with msdb There are cases above script used in stored procedure or part of big query, it is not possible to change the context of the whole query to any specific database. Use three part naming convention and prefix them with msdb. SELECT name, database_name, backup_size, TYPE, compatibility_level, backup_set_id FROM msdb.dbo.backupset; SELECT logical_name, backup_size, file_type FROM msdb.dbo.backupfile; Very simple solution but sometime keeps people wondering for an answer.   • ASP.NET Server-side comments

    - by nmarun
    I believe a good number of you know about Server-side commenting. This blog is just like a revival to refresh your memories. When you write comments in your .aspx/.ascx files, people usually write them as: 1: <!-- This is a comment. --> To show that it actually makes a difference for using the server-side commenting technique, I’ve started a web application project and my default.aspx page looks like this: 1: <%@ Page Title="Home Page" Language="C#" MasterPageFile="~/Site.master" AutoEventWireup="true" CodeBehind="Default.aspx.cs" Inherits="ServerSideComment._Default" %> 2: <asp:Content ID="HeaderContent" runat="server" ContentPlaceHolderID="HeadContent"> 3: </asp:Content> 4: <asp:Content ID="BodyContent" runat="server" ContentPlaceHolderID="MainContent"> 5: <h2> 6: <!-- This is a comment --> 7: Welcome to ASP.NET! 8: </h2> 9: <p> 10: To learn more about ASP.NET visit <a href="http://www.asp.net" title="ASP.NET Website">www.asp.net</a>. 11: </p> 12: <p> 13: You can also find <a href="http://go.microsoft.com/fwlink/?LinkID=152368&amp;clcid=0x409" 14: title="MSDN ASP.NET Docs">documentation on ASP.NET at MSDN</a>. 15: </p> 16: </asp:Content> See the comment in line 6 and when I run the app, I can do a view source on the browser which shows up as: 1: <h2> 2: <!-- This is a comment --> 3: Welcome to ASP.NET! 4: </h2> Using Fiddler shows the page size as: Let’s change the comment style and use server-side commenting technique. 1: <h2> 2: <%-- This is a comment --%> 3: Welcome to ASP.NET! 4: </h2> Upon rendering, the view source looks like: 1: <h2> 2: 3: Welcome to ASP.NET! 4: </h2> Fiddler now shows the page size as: The difference is that client-side comments are ignored by the browser, but they are still sent down the pipe. With server-side comments, the compiler ignores everything inside this block. Visual Studio’s Text Editor toolbar also puts comments as server-side ones. If you want to give it a shot, go to your design page and press Ctrl+K, Ctrl+C on some selected text and you’ll see it commented in the server-side commenting style.

  • Queued Loadtest to remove Concurrency issues using Shared Data Service in OpenScript

    - by stefan.thieme(at)oracle.com
    Queued Processing to remove Concurrency issues in Loadtest ScriptsSome scripts act on information returned by the server, e.g. act on first item in the returned list of pending tasks/actions. This may lead to concurrency issues if the virtual users simulated in a load test scenario are not synchronized in some way.As the load test cases should be carried out in a comparable and straight forward manner simply cancel a transaction in case a collision occurs is clearly not an option. In case you increase the number of virtual users this approach would lead to a high number of requests for the early steps in your transaction (e.g. login, retrieve list of action points, assign an action point to the virtual user) but later steps would be rarely visited successfully or at all, depending on the application logic.A way to tackle this problem is to enqueue the virtual users in a Shared Data Service queue. Only the first virtual user in this queue will be allowed to carry out the critical steps (retrieve list of action points, assign an action point to the virtual user) in your transaction at any one time.Once a virtual user has passed the critical path it will dequeue himself from the head of the queue and continue with his actions. This does theoretically allow virtual users to run in parallel all steps of the transaction which are not part of the critical path.In practice it has been seen this is rarely the case, though it does not allow adding more than N users to perform a transaction without causing delays due to virtual users waiting in the queue. N being the time of the total transaction divided by the sum of the time of all critical steps in this transaction.While this problem can be circumvented by allowing multiple queues to act on individual segments of the list of actions, e.g. per country filter, ends with 0..9 filter, etc.This would require additional handling of these additional queues of slots for the virtual users at the head of the queue in order to maintain the mutually exclusive access to the first element in the list returned by the server at any one time of the load test. Such an improved handling of multiple queues and/or multiple slots is above the subject of this paper.Shared Data Services Pre-RequisitesStart WebLogic Server to host Shared Data ServicesYou will have to make sure that your WebLogic server is installed and started. Shared Data Services may not work if you installed only the minimal installation package for OpenScript. If however you installed the default package including OLT and OTM, you may follow the instructions below to start and verify WebLogic installation.To start the WebLogic Server deployed underneath of Oracle Load Testing and/or Oracle Test Manager you can go to your Start menu, Oracle Application Testing Suite and select the Restart Oracle Application Testing Suite Application Service entry from the Tools submenu.To verify the service has been started you can run the Microsoft Management Console for Services by Selecting Run from the Start Menu and entering services.msc. Look for the entry that reads Oracle Application Testing Suite Application Service, once it has changed it status from Starting to Started you can proceed to verify the login. Please note that this may take several minutes, I would say up to 10 minutes depending on the strength of your CPU horse-power.Verify WebLogic Server user credentialsYou will have to make sure that your WebLogic Server is installed and started. Next open the Oracle WebLogic Server Adminstration Console on http://localhost:8088/console.It may take a while until the application is deployed and started. It may display the following until the Administration Console has been deployed on the fly.Afterwards you can login using the username oats and the password that you selected during install time for your Application Testing Suite administrative purposes.This will bring up the Home page of you WebLogic Server. You have actually verified that you are able to login with these credentials already. However if you want to check the details, navigate to Security Realms, myrealm, Users and Groups tab.Here you could add users to your WebLogic Server which could be used in the later steps. Details on the Groups required for such a custom user to work are exceeding this quick overview and have to be selected with the WebLogic Server Adminstration Guide in mind.Shared Data Services pre-requisites for Load testingOpenScript Preferences have to be set to enable Encryption and provide a default Shared Data Service Connection for Playback.These are pre-requisites you want to use for load testing with Shared Data Services.Please note that the usage of the Connection Parameters (individual directive in the script) for Shared Data Services did not playback reliably in the current version 9.20.0370 of Oracle Load Testing (OLT) and encryption of credentials still seemed to be mandatory as well.General Encryption settingsSelect OpenScript Preferences from the View menu and navigate to the General, Encryption entry in the tree on the left. Select the Encrypt script data option from the list and enter the same password that you used for securing your WebLogic Server Administration Console.Enable global shared data access credentialsSelect OpenScript Preferences from the View menu and navigate to the Playback, Shared Data entry in the tree on the left. Enable the global shared data access credentials and enter the Address, User name and Password determined for your WebLogic Server to host Shared Data Services.Please note, that you may want to replace the localhost in Address with the hosts realname in case you plan to run load tests with Loadtest Agents running on remote systems.Queued Processing of TransactionsEnable Shared Data Services Module in Script PropertiesThe Shared Data Services Module has to be enabled for each Script that wants to employ the Shared Data Service Queue functionality in OpenScript. It can be enabled under the Script menu selecting Script Properties. On the Script Properties Dialog select the Modules section and check Shared Data to enable Shared Data Service Module for your script. Checking the Shared Data Services option will effectively add a line to your script code that adds the sharedData ScriptService to your script class of IteratingVUserScript.@ScriptService oracle.oats.scripting.modules.sharedData.api.SharedDataService sharedData;Record your scriptRecord your script as usual and then add the following things for Queue handling in the Initialize code block, before the first step and after the last step of your critical path and in the Finalize code block.The java code to be added at individual locations is explained in the following sections in full detail.Create a Shared Data Queue in InitializeTo create a Shared Data Queue go to the Java view of your script and enter the following statements to the initialize() code block.info("Create queueA with life time of 120 minutes");sharedData.createQueue("queueA", 120);This will create an instantiation of the Shared Data Queue object named queueA which is maintained for upto 120 minutes.If you want to use the code for multiple scripts, make sure to use a different queue name for each one here and in the subsequent steps. You may even consider to use a dynamic queueName based on filters of your result list being concurrently accessed.Prepare a unique id for each IterationIn order to keep track of individual virtual users in our queue we need to create a unique identifier from the virtual user id and the used username right after retrieving the next record from our databank file.getDatabank("Usernames").getNextDatabankRecord();getVariables().set("usernameValue1","VU_{{@vuid}}_{{@iterationnum}}_{{db.Usernames.Username}}_{{@timestamp}}_{{@random(10000)}}");String usernameValue = getVariables().get("usernameValue1");info("Now running virtual user " + usernameValue);As you can see from the above code block, we have set the OpenScript variable usernameValue1 to VU_{{@vuid}}_{{@iterationnum}}_{{db.Usernames.Username}}_{{@timestamp}}_{{@random(10000)}} which is a concatenation of the virtual user id and the iterationnumber for general uniqueness; as well as the username from our databank, the timestamp and a random number for making it further unique and ease spotting of errors.Not all of these fields are actually required to make it really unique, but adding the queue name may also be considered to help troubleshoot multiple queues.The value is then retrieved with the getVariables.get() method call and assigned to the usernameValue String used throughout the script.Please note that moving the getDatabank("Usernames").getNextDatabankRecord(); call to the initialize block was later considered to remove concurrency of multiple virtual users running with the same userid and therefor accessing the same "My Inbox" in step 6. This will effectively give each virtual user a userid from the databank file. Make sure you have enough userids to remove this second hurdle.Enqueue and attend Queue before Critical PathTo maintain the right order of virtual users being allowed into the critical path of the transaction the following pseudo step has to be added in front of the first critical step. In the case of this example this is right in front of the step where we retrieve the list of actions from which we select the first to be assigned to us.beginStep("[0] Waiting in the Queue", 0);{info("Enqueued virtual user " + usernameValue + " at the end of queueA");sharedData.offerLast("queueA", usernameValue);info("Wait until the user is the first in queueA");String queueValue1 = null;do {// we wait for at least 0.7 seconds before we check the head of the// queue. This is the time it takes one user to move through the// critical path, i.e. pass steps [5] Enter country and [6] Assign// to meThread.sleep(700);queueValue1 = (String) sharedData.peekFirst("queueA");info("The first user in queueA is currently: '" + queueValue1 + "' " + queueValue1.getClass() + " length " + queueValue1.length() );info("The current user is '"+ usernameValue + "' " + usernameValue.getClass() + " length " + usernameValue.length() + ": indexOf " + usernameValue.indexOf(queueValue1) + " equals " + usernameValue.equals(queueValue1) );} while ( queueValue1.indexOf(usernameValue) < 0 );info("Now the user is the first in queueA");}endStep();This will enqueue the username to the tail of our Queue. It will will wait for at least 700 milliseconds, the time it takes for one user to exit the critical path and then compare the head of our queue with it's username. This last step will be repeated while the two are not equal (indexOf less than zero). If they are equal the indexOf will yield a value of zero or larger and we will perform the critical steps.Dequeue after Critical PathAfter the virtual user has left the critical path and complete its last step the following code block needs to dequeue the virtual user. In the case of our example this is right after the action has been actually assigned to the virtual user. This will allow the next virtual user to retrieve the list of actions still available and in turn let him make his selection/assignment.info("Get and remove the current user from the head of queueA");String pollValue1 = (String) sharedData.pollFirst("queueA");The current user is removed from the head of the queue. The next one will now be able to match his username against the head of the queue.Clear and Destroy Queue for FinishWhen the script has completed, it should clear and destroy the queue. This code block can be put in the finish block of your script and/or in a separate script in order to clear and remove the queue in case you have spotted an error or want to reset the queue for some reason.info("Clear queueA");sharedData.clearQueue("queueA");info("Destroy queueA");sharedData.destroyQueue("queueA");The users waiting in queueA are cleared and the queue is destroyed. If you have scripts still executing they will be caught in a loop.I found it better to maintain a separate Reset Queue script which contained only the following code in the initialize() block. I use to call this script to make sure the queue is cleared in between multiple Loadtest runs. This script could also even be added as the first in a larger scenario, which would execute it only once at very start of the Loadtest and make sure the queues do not contain any stale entries.info("Create queueA with life time of 120 minutes");sharedData.createQueue("queueA", 120);info("Clear queueA");sharedData.clearQueue("queueA");This will create a Shared Data Queue instance of queueA and clear all entries from this queue.Monitoring QueueWhile creating the scripts it was useful to monitor the contents, i.e. the current first user in the Queue. The following code block will make sure the Shared Data Queue is accessible in the initialize() block.info("Create queueA with life time of 120 minutes");sharedData.createQueue("queueA", 120);In the run() block the following code will continuously monitor the first element of the Queue and write an informational message with the current username Value to the Result window.info("Monitor the first users in queueA");String queueValue1 = null;do {queueValue1 = (String) sharedData.peekFirst("queueA");if (queueValue1 != null)info("The first user in queueA is currently: '" + queueValue1 + "' " + queueValue1.getClass() + " length " + queueValue1.length() );} while ( true );This script can be run from OpenScript parallel to a loadtest performed by the Oracle Load Test.However it is not recommend to run this in a production loadtest as the performance impact is unknown. Accessing the Queue's head with the peekFirst() method has been reported with about 2 seconds response time by both OpenScript and OTL. It is advised to log a Service Request to see if this could be lowered in future releases of Application Testing Suite, as the pollFirst() and even offerLast() writing to the tail of the Queue usually returned after an average 0.1 seconds.Debugging QueueWhile debugging the scripts the following was useful to remove single entries from its head, i.e. the current first user in the Queue.   • What's up with LDoms: Part 1 - Introduction & Basic Concepts

    - by Stefan Hinker
    LDoms - the correct name is Oracle VM Server for SPARC - have been around for quite a while now.  But to my surprise, I get more and more requests to explain how they work or to give advise on how to make good use of them.  This made me think that writing up a few articles discussing the different features would be a good idea.  Now - I don't intend to rewrite the LDoms Admin Guide or to copy and reformat the (hopefully) well known "Beginners Guide to LDoms" by Tony Shoumack from 2007.  Those documents are very recommendable - especially the Beginners Guide, although based on LDoms 1.0, is still a good place to begin with.  However, LDoms have come a long way since then, and I hope to contribute to their adoption by discussing how they work and what features there are today.  In this and the following posts, I will use the term "LDoms" as a common abbreviation for Oracle VM Server for SPARC, just because it's a lot shorter and easier to type (and presumably, read). So, just to get everyone on the same baseline, lets briefly discuss the basic concepts of virtualization with LDoms.  LDoms make use of a hypervisor as a layer of abstraction between real, physical hardware and virtual hardware.  This virtual hardware is then used to create a number of guest systems which each behave very similar to a system running on bare metal:  Each has its own OBP, each will install its own copy of the Solaris OS and each will see a certain amount of CPU, memory, disk and network resources available to it.  Unlike some other type 1 hypervisors running on x86 hardware, the SPARC hypervisor is embedded in the system firmware and makes use both of supporting functions in the sun4v SPARC instruction set as well as the overall CPU architecture to fulfill its function. The CMT architecture of the supporting CPUs (T1 through T4) provide a large number of cores and threads to the OS.  For example, the current T4 CPU has eight cores, each running 8 threads, for a total of 64 threads per socket.  To the OS, this looks like 64 CPUs.  The SPARC hypervisor, when creating guest systems, simply assigns a certain number of these threads exclusively to one guest, thus avoiding the overhead of having to schedule OS threads to CPUs, as do typical x86 hypervisors.  The hypervisor only assigns CPUs and then steps aside.  It is not involved in the actual work being dispatched from the OS to the CPU, all it does is maintain isolation between different guests. Likewise, memory is assigned exclusively to individual guests.  Here,  the hypervisor provides generic mappings between the physical hardware addresses and the guest's views on memory.  Again, the hypervisor is not involved in the actual memory access, it only maintains isolation between guests. During the inital setup of a system with LDoms, you start with one special domain, called the Control Domain.  Initially, this domain owns all the hardware available in the system, including all CPUs, all RAM and all IO resources.  If you'd be running the system un-virtualized, this would be what you'd be working with.  To allow for guests, you first resize this initial domain (also called a primary domain in LDoms speak), assigning it a small amount of CPU and memory.  This frees up most of the available CPU and memory resources for guest domains.  IO is a little more complex, but very straightforward.  When LDoms 1.0 first came out, the only way to provide IO to guest systems was to create virtual disk and network services and attach guests to these services.  In the meantime, several different ways to connect guest domains to IO have been developed, the most recent one being SR-IOV support for network devices released in version 2.2 of Oracle VM Server for SPARC. I will cover these more advanced features in detail later.  For now, lets have a short look at the initial way IO was virtualized in LDoms: For virtualized IO, you create two services, one "Virtual Disk Service" or vds, and one "Virtual Switch" or vswitch.  You can, of course, also create more of these, but that's more advanced than I want to cover in this introduction.  These IO services now connect real, physical IO resources like a disk LUN or a networt port to the virtual devices that are assigned to guest domains.  For disk IO, the normal case would be to connect a physical LUN (or some other storage option that I'll discuss later) to one specific guest.  That guest would be assigned a virtual disk, which would appear to be just like a real LUN to the guest, while the IO is actually routed through the virtual disk service down to the physical device.  For network, the vswitch acts very much like a real, physical ethernet switch - you connect one physical port to it for outside connectivity and define one or more connections per guest, just like you would plug cables between a real switch and a real system. For completeness, there is another service that provides console access to guest domains which mimics the behavior of serial terminal servers. The connections between the virtual devices on the guest's side and the virtual IO services in the primary domain are created by the hypervisor.  It uses so called "Logical Domain Channels" or LDCs to create point-to-point connections between all of these devices and services.  These LDCs work very similar to high speed serial connections and are configured automatically whenever the Control Domain adds or removes virtual IO. To see all this in action, now lets look at a first example.  I will start with a newly installed machine and configure the control domain so that it's ready to create guest systems. In a first step, after we've installed the software, let's start the virtual console service and downsize the primary domain.  root@sun # ldm list NAME STATE FLAGS CONS VCPU MEMORY UTIL UPTIME primary active -n-c-- UART 512 261632M 0.3% 2d 13h 58m root@sun # ldm add-vconscon port-range=5000-5100 \ primary-console primary root@sun # svcadm enable vntsd root@sun # svcs vntsd STATE STIME FMRI online 9:53:21 svc:/ldoms/vntsd:default root@sun # ldm set-vcpu 16 primary root@sun # ldm set-mau 1 primary root@sun # ldm start-reconf primary root@sun # ldm set-memory 7680m primary root@sun # ldm add-config initial root@sun # shutdown -y -g0 -i6 So what have I done: I've defined a range of ports (5000-5100) for the virtual network terminal service and then started that service.  The vnts will later provide console connections to guest systems, very much like serial NTS's do in the physical world. Next, I assigned 16 vCPUs (on this platform, a T3-4, that's two cores) to the primary domain, freeing the rest up for future guest systems.  I also assigned one MAU to this domain.  A MAU is a crypto unit in the T3 CPU.  These need to be explicitly assigned to domains, just like CPU or memory.  (This is no longer the case with T4 systems, where crypto is always available everywhere.) Before I reassigned the memory, I started what's called a "delayed reconfiguration" session.  That avoids actually doing the change right away, which would take a considerable amount of time in this case.  Instead, I'll need to reboot once I'm all done.  I've assigned 7680MB of RAM to the primary.  That's 8GB less the 512MB which the hypervisor uses for it's own private purposes.  You can, depending on your needs, work with less.  I'll spend a dedicated article on sizing, discussing the pros and cons in detail. Finally, just before the reboot, I saved my work on the ILOM, to make this configuration available after a powercycle of the box.  (It'll always be available after a simple reboot, but the ILOM needs to know the configuration of the hypervisor after a power-cycle, before the primary domain is booted.) Now, lets create a first disk service and a first virtual switch which is connected to the physical network device igb2. We will later use these to connect virtual disks and virtual network ports of our guest systems to real world storage and network. root@sun # ldm add-vds primary-vds root@sun # ldm add-vswitch net-dev=igb2 switch-primary primary You are free to choose whatever names you like for the virtual disk service and the virtual switch.  I strongly recommend that you choose names that make sense to you and describe the function of each service in the context of your implementation.  For the vswitch, for example, you could choose names like "admin-vswitch" or "production-network" etc. This already concludes the configuration of the control domain.  We've freed up considerable amounts of CPU and RAM for guest systems and created the necessary infrastructure - console, vts and vswitch - so that guests systems can actually interact with the outside world.  The system is now ready to create guests, which I'll describe in the next section.   • Clustering Basics and Challenges

    - by Karoly Vegh
    For upcoming posts it seemed to be a good idea to dedicate some time for cluster basic concepts and theory. This post misses a lot of details that would explode the articlesize, should you have questions, do not hesitate to ask them in the comments.  The goal here is to get some concepts straight. I can't promise to give you an overall complete definitions of cluster, cluster agent, quorum, voting, fencing, split brain condition, so the following is more of an explanation. Here we go. -------- Cluster, HA, failover, switchover, scalability -------- An attempted definition of a Cluster: A cluster is a set (2+) server nodes dedicated to keep application services alive, communicating through the cluster software/framework with eachother, test and probe health status of servernodes/services and with quorum based decisions and with switchover/failover techniques keep the application services running on them available. That is, should a node that runs a service unexpectedly lose functionality/connection, the other ones would take over the and run the services, so that availability is guaranteed. To provide availability while strictly sticking to a consistent clusterconfiguration is the main goal of a cluster.  At this point we have to add that this defines a HA-cluster, a High-Availability cluster, where the clusternodes are planned to run the services in an active-standby, or failover fashion. An example could be a single instance database. Some applications can be run in a distributed or scalable fashion. In the latter case instances of the application run actively on separate clusternodes serving servicerequests simultaneously. An example for this version could be a webserver that forwards connection requests to many backend servers in a round-robin way. Or a database running in active-active RAC setup.  -------- Cluster arhitecture, interconnect, topologies -------- Now, what is a cluster made of? Servers, right. These servers (the clusternodes) need to communicate. This of course happens over the network, usually over dedicated network interfaces interconnecting all the clusternodes. These connection are called interconnects.How many clusternodes are in a cluster? There are different cluster topologies. The most simple one is a clustered pair topology, involving only two clusternodes:  There are several more topologies, clicking the image above will take you to the relevant documentation. Also, to answer the question Solaris Cluster allows you to run up to 16 servers in a cluster. Where shall these clusternodes be placed? A very important question. The right answer is: It depends on what you plan to achieve with the cluster. Do you plan to avoid only a server outage? Then you can place them right next to eachother in the datacenter. Do you need to avoid DataCenter outage? In that case of course you should place them at least in different fire zones. Or in two geographically distant DataCenters to avoid disasters like floods, large-scale fires or power outages. We call this a stretched- or campus cluster, the clusternodes being several kilometers away from eachother. To cover really large distances, you probably need to move to a GeoCluster, which is a different kind of animal.  What is a geocluster? A Geographic Cluster in Solaris Cluster terms is actually a metacluster between two, separate (locally-HA) clusters.  -------- Cluster resource types, agents, resources, resource groups -------- So how does the cluster manage my applications? The cluster needs to start, stop and probe your applications. If you application runs, the cluster needs to check regularly if the application state is healthy, does it respond over the network, does it have all the processes running, etc. This is called probing. If the cluster deems the application is in a faulty state, then it can try to restart it locally or decide to switch (stop on node A, start on node B) the service. Starting, stopping and probing are the three actions that a cluster agent does. There are many different kinds of agents included in Solaris Cluster, but you can build your own too. Examples are an agent that manages (mounts, moves) ZFS filesystems, or the Oracle DB HA agent that cares about the database, or an agent that moves a floating IP address between nodes. There are lots of other agents included for Apache, Tomcat, MySQL, Oracle DB, Oracle Weblogic, Zones, LDoms, NFS, DNS, etc.We also need to clarify the difference between a cluster resource and the cluster resource group.A cluster resource is something that is managed by a cluster agent. Cluster resource types are included in Solaris cluster (see above, e.g. HAStoragePlus, HA-Oracle, LogicalHost). You can group cluster resources into cluster resourcegroups, and switch these groups together from one node to another. To stick to the example above, to move an Oracle DB service from one node to another, you have to switch the group between nodes, and the agents of the cluster resources in the group will do the following:  On node A Shut down the DB Unconfigure the LogicalHost IP the DB Listener listens on unmount the filesystem   Then, on node B: mount the FS configure the IP  startup the DB -------- Voting, Quorum, Split Brain Condition, Fencing, Amnesia -------- How do the clusternodes agree upon their action? How do they decide which node runs what services? Another important question. Running a cluster is a strictly democratic thing.Every node has votes, and you need the majority of votes to have the deciding power. Now, this is usually no problem, clusternodes think very much all alike. Still, every action needs to be governed upon in a productive system, and has to be agreed upon. Agreeing is easy as long as the clusternodes all behave and talk to eachother over the interconnect. But if the interconnect is gone/down, this all gets tricky and confusing. Clusternodes think like this: "My job is to run these services. The other node does not answer my interconnect communication, it must be down. I'd better take control and run the services!". The problem is, as I have already mentioned, clusternodes very much think alike. If the interconnect is gone, they all assume the other node is down, and they all want to mount the data backend, enable the IP and run the database. Double IPs, double mounts, double DB instances - now that is trouble. Also, in a 2-node cluster they both have only 50% of the votes, that is, they themselves alone are not allowed to run a cluster.  This is where you need a quorum device. According to Wikipedia, the "requirement for a quorum is protection against totally unrepresentative action in the name of the body by an unduly small number of persons.". They need additional votes to run the cluster. For this requirement a 2-node cluster needs a quorum device or a quorum server. If the interconnect is gone, (this is what we call a split brain condition) both nodes start to race and try to reserve the quorum device to themselves. They do this, because the quorum device bears an additional vote, that could ensure majority (50% +1). The one that manages to lock the quorum device (e.g. if it's an FC LUN, it SCSI reserves it) wins the right to build/run a cluster, the other one - realizing he was late - panics/reboots to ensure the cluster config stays consistent.  Losing the interconnect isn't only endangering the availability of services, but it also endangers the cluster configuration consistence. Just imagine node A being down and during that the cluster configuration changes. Now node B goes down, and node A comes up. It isn't uptodate about the cluster configuration's changes so it will refuse to start a cluster, since that would lead to cluster amnesia, that is the cluster had some changes, but now runs with an older cluster configuration repository state, that is it's like it forgot about the changes.  Also, to ensure application data consistence, the clusternode that wins the race makes sure that a server that isn't part of or can't currently join the cluster can access the devices. This procedure is called fencing. This usually happens to storage LUNs via SCSI reservation.  Now, another important question: Where do I place the quorum disk?  Imagine having two sites, two separate datacenters, one in the north of the city and the other one in the south part of it. You run a stretched cluster in the clustered pair topology. Where do you place the quorum disk/server? If you put it into the north DC, and that gets hit by a meteor, you lose one clusternode, which isn't a problem, but you also lose your quorum, and the south clusternode can't keep the cluster running lacking the votes. This problem can't be solved with two sites and a campus cluster. You will need a third site to either place the quorum server to, or a third clusternode. Otherwise, lacking majority, if you lose the site that had your quorum, you lose the cluster. Okay, we covered the very basics.   • Weblogic domain scale up using EM Grid Control 11gR1

    - by dmitry.nefedkin(at)oracle.com
    As you know a weblogic domain consists of set of servers running independently or in a cluster mode, sharing the distributed resources. And in most environments weblogic  cluster consists of multiple managed servers running simultaneously and working together to provide increased scalability and reliability.  These servers can run on the same machine, or be located on different machines.  It's a common task to increase a cluster's capacity by adding new machines to the cluster to host the new server instances.  You can do it by manually installing weblogic binaries to the new host and use pack/unpack commands to add a managed server to this new host.  But with Enterprise Manager Grid Control 11gR1 (EMGC) there is  another way - Fusion Middleware Domain Scale Up  procedure. I'm going to show you how it works.Here is a picture of  my medrec_oradb weblogic domain, what is registered in EMGC. It contains an admin server and a cluster MedRecCluster with  the single managed server MS1. Both admin and managed servers are on the same host oel46-vmware, it's a virtual machine with OEL 4.6 that runs inside our Oracle VM infrastructure.  And here are the application deployments, note that couple of applications are deployed to the cluster.First of all I have to prepare a new machine that will host new managed sever of my cluster. I created new VM with OEL 5.4 using the corresponding Oracle VM template available in Oracle E-Delivery site for Oracle Linux and Oracle VM and named it wls1032. Next step is to install Oracle EM Grid Control 11gR1 Agent to this new host.  You can download it from the OTN page and install it manually,  or you can use Agent Installation Deployment procedure available in EMGC  (Deployments->Agent Installation->Install Agent). Anyway, when you agent is up and running on the new machine, you will see it in EMGC Console in the Targets->Hosts subtab.Now we are ready to scale up our weblogic domain. Click the Deployments tab in Oracle Enterprise Manager Grid Control, and then click Deployment Procedure. Select a Fusion Middleware Domain Scale Up procedure from the list, and click Schedule Deployment. The first page of the FMW Domain Scale Up Wizard is displayed and you can proceed with the deployment process.Select the domain from list, enter the working directory on the admin server host, and also fill the weblogic credentials for the administration server console and the OS credentials for the  admin server host.  Click Next button.  The next step allows you to configure you domain, to add a new manager server to the cluster you should select the cluster in the tree and click Add Server button. Select the newly added server in a tree, choose the target host and  enter the configuration details of your managed server. You can also add new machine and node manager details.  Please note that you cannot change the values in  Domain Location and Fusion Middleware Home fields, so these locations on the target host will be the same as for the admin server host.   Working directory on the target host should have enough free space to store FMW home binaries and domain configuration files.  In my experience the working directories should have at least 3 Gb of free space.  The last thing you should fill is the OS credentials for the target host. The next steps allows you to schedule the execution of the procedure, it is started immediately in my example. The last step is just a review the configuration for the domain scale up. Click Submit to launch the process. You can track the status of the procedure execution by selecting Deployments->Deployment Procedures->Procedure Completion Status in the EMGC Console.As you can see in the picture below, the procedure consists of the many steps, and I'm going to share my experience about the issues that I had at some of the steps. Please keep in mind that you can always continue the execution from the last successfully completed step by clicking Retry button.Check OUI Prerequisites  step may fail if the target host does  not pass prerequisites checks for Weblogic Server installation such as amount of RAM, linux packages installed, etc. Create FMW Clone Archive step may fail if you do not have enough free space in the working directory on the administration server host.Transfer cloning archive to targets  step  may fail if the EMGC agents on the admin server host or on target host are not secured.   You should secure the agent by issuing ./emctl secure agent  command from $AGENT_HOME/bin directory and entering the agent registration password.Both Transfer cloning archive to targets and Apply Clone at target hosts steps may fail if you do not have enough free space in the working directory on the target host. The most complicated issue I had on the Run Inventory Collection  step. The step failed and I noticed that the agent on the target server is also failed with the following error in the $AGENT_HOME/sysman/log/emagent.trc  log file:2010-12-28 11:50:34,310 Thread-2838952848 ERROR upload: Failed to upload file A0000008.xml: Fatal Error.Response received: 500|ORA-20603: The timezone of the multiagent target (/Farm_Localhost_MedRec_medrec_oradb/medrec_oradb,weblogic_domain)is not consistent with the timezone (America/Los_Angeles) reported by other agents.2010-12-28 11:50:34,310 Thread-2838952848 ERROR upload: 1 Failure(s) in a row or XML error for A0000008.xml, retcode = -6, we give up2010-12-28 11:50:35,552 Thread-2838952848 WARN  upload: FxferSend: received fatal error in header from repository: https://oel46-vmware:1159/em/uploadFATAL_ERROR::500|ORA-20603: The timezone of the multiagent target (/Farm_Localhost_MedRec_medrec_oradb/medrec_oradb,weblogic_domain)is not consistent with the timezone (America/Los_Angeles) reported by other agents.2010-12-28 11:50:35,552 Thread-2838952848 ERROR upload: number of fatal error exceeds the limit 32010-12-28 11:50:35,552 Thread-2838952848 ERROR upload: agent will shutdown now2010-12-28 11:50:35,552 Thread-2838952848 ERROR : Signalled to Exit with status 55. Too many fatal upload failures2010-12-28 11:50:35,552 Thread-2838952848 ERROR upload: 1 Failure(s) in a row or XML error for A0000008.xml, retcode = -6, we give up2010-12-28 11:50:35,552 Thread-3044607680 ERROR main: EMAgent abnormal terminatingI checked the timezone of my domain target inside EMGC repositoryselect timezone_regionfrom mgmt_targets where target_type = 'weblogic_domain'  and display_name = 'medrec_oradb'"TIMEZONE_REGION""America/Los_Angeles"Then checked the timezone of my agents and indeed, they differedselect target_name, timezone_region from mgmt_targets where type_display_name = 'Agent'"TARGET_NAME"    "TIMEZONE_REGION""oel46-vmware:3872"    "America/Los_Angeles""wls1032.imc.fors.ru:3872"    "America/New_York"So I had to change the timezone on the wls1032 host and propagate this changes to the agent and to the EMGC repository. Here was the steps:issued system-config-date command on wls1032.imc.fors.ru  and set timezone to "America/Los_Angeles"propagated the changes to the agent bu executing ./emctl resetTZ agent  command from $AGENT_HOME/bin directoryconnected to EMGC repository as sysman and executed the following PL/SQL block:   begin      mgmt_target.set_agent_tzrgn('wls1032.imc.fors.ru:3872','America/Los_Angeles');      commit;   end;After that I had to clear the pending uploads on wls1032.imc.fors.ru:  rm -r $AGENT_HOME/sysman/emd/state/*  rm -r $AGENT_HOME/sysman/emd/collection/*  rm -r $AGENT_HOME/sysman/emd/upload/*  rm $AGENT_HOME/sysman/emd/lastupld.xml  rm $AGENT_HOME/sysman/emd/agntstmp.txt  $AGENT_HOME/bin/emctl start agent  $AGENT_HOME/bin/emctl clearstate agentThe last part of this solution was to resync the agent in EMGC console by clicking Agent Resynchronization button (please leave "Unblock agent on successful completion of agent resynchronization" checkbox checked in the next screen).After that I issued ./emctl upload command from $AGENT_HOME/bin on the wls1032 host,  and my previous error disappeared,  but I catched another one: EMD upload error: Failed to upload file A0000004.xml: HTTP error.Response received: ERROR-400|Data will be rejected for upload from agent 'https://wls1032.imc.fors.ru:3872/emd/main/', max size limit for direct load exceeded [7544731/5242880]So the uploading XML file size was 7 Mb, and the limit on OMS was 5 Mb.  To increase the max file size limit to 20 Mb I had to connect to the OMS host and execute the following commands from $OMS_HOME/bin directory: ./emctl set property -name em.loader.maxDirectLoadFileSz -value 20971520 -module emoms ./emctl stop oms ./emctl start omsAfter that I issued ./emctl upload command from $AGENT_HOME/bin on the wls1032 one more time and it completed successfully.   The agent uploaded the configuration information to the EMGC  repository and I was able to see the results of my weblogic domain scale-up in EMGC Console.DeploymentsSo, now the weblogic cluster contains 2 managed servers located on the different hosts. This powerful feature of the Enterprise Manager Grid Control  is a part of  the WebLogic Server Management Pack Enterprise Edition.

  • Microsoft ReportViewer SetParameters continuous refresh issue

    - by Ilya Verbitskiy
    Originally posted on: http://geekswithblogs.net/ilich/archive/2013/10/16/microsoft-reportviewer-setparameters-continuous-refresh-issue.aspxI am a big fun of using ASP.NET MVC for building web-applications. It allows us to create simple, robust and testable solutions. However, .NET world is not perfect. There is tons of code written in ASP.NET web-forms. You cannot simply ignore it, even if you want to. Sometimes ASP.NET web-forms controls bring us non-obvious issues. The good example is Microsoft ReportViewer control. I have an example for you. 1: <%@ Page Language="C#" AutoEventWireup="true" CodeFile="Default.aspx.cs" Inherits="_Default" %> 2: <%@ Register Assembly="Microsoft.ReportViewer.WebForms, Version=11.0.0.0, Culture=neutral, PublicKeyToken=89845dcd8080cc91" Namespace="Microsoft.Reporting.WebForms" TagPrefix="rsweb" %> 3:   4: <!DOCTYPE html> 5:   6: <html xmlns="http://www.w3.org/1999/xhtml"> 7: <head runat="server"> 8: <title>Report Viewer Continiuse Resfresh Issue Example</title> 9: </head> 10: <body> 11: <form id="form1" runat="server"> 12: <div> 13: <asp:ScriptManager runat="server"></asp:ScriptManager> 14: <rsweb:ReportViewer ID="_reportViewer" runat="server" Width="100%" Height="100%"></rsweb:ReportViewer> 15: </div> 16: </form> 17: </body> 18: </html>   The back-end code is simple as well. I want to show a report with some parameters to a user. 1: protected void Page_Load(object sender, EventArgs e) 2: { 3: _reportViewer.ProcessingMode = ProcessingMode.Remote; 4: _reportViewer.ShowParameterPrompts = false; 5:   6: var serverReport = _reportViewer.ServerReport; 7: serverReport.ReportServerUrl = new Uri("http://localhost/ReportServer_SQLEXPRESS"); 8: serverReport.ReportPath = "/Reports/TestReport"; 9:   10: var reportParameter1 = new ReportParameter("Parameter1"); 11: reportParameter1.Values.Add("Hello World!"); 12:   13: var reportParameter2 = new ReportParameter("Parameter2"); 14: reportParameter2.Values.Add("10/16/2013"); 15:   16: var reportParameter3 = new ReportParameter("Parameter3"); 17: reportParameter3.Values.Add("10"); 18:   19: serverReport.SetParameters(new[] { reportParameter1, reportParameter2, reportParameter3 }); 20: }   I set ShowParametersPrompts to false because I do not want user to refine the search. It looks good until you run the report. The report will refresh itself all the time. The problem caused by ServerReport.SetParameters method in Page_Load. The method cause ReportViewer control to execute the report on the NEXT post back. That is why the page has continuous post-backs. The fix is very simple: do nothing if Page_Load method executed during post-back. 1: protected void Page_Load(object sender, EventArgs e) 2: { 3: if (IsPostBack) 4: { 5: return; 6: } 7:   8: _reportViewer.ProcessingMode = ProcessingMode.Remote; 9: _reportViewer.ShowParameterPrompts = false; 10:   11: var serverReport = _reportViewer.ServerReport; 12: serverReport.ReportServerUrl = new Uri("http://localhost/ReportServer_SQLEXPRESS"); 13: serverReport.ReportPath = "/Reports/TestReport"; 14:   15: var reportParameter1 = new ReportParameter("Parameter1"); 16: reportParameter1.Values.Add("Hello World!"); 17:   18: var reportParameter2 = new ReportParameter("Parameter2"); 19: reportParameter2.Values.Add("10/16/2013"); 20:   21: var reportParameter3 = new ReportParameter("Parameter3"); 22: reportParameter3.Values.Add("10"); 23:   24: serverReport.SetParameters(new[] { reportParameter1, reportParameter2, reportParameter3 }); 25: } You can download sample code from GitHub - https://github.com/ilich/Examples/tree/master/ReportViewerContinuousRefresh
